Mittens the Moonlight Spy
Mittens was no ordinary cat. While other cats spent their days napping in sunbeams, Mittens had a secret job — she was a spy. Every night, when the house grew quiet, she'd creep through the shadows with her whiskers twitching, looking for magical mysteries.
One starry evening, Mittens spotted something strange through the window. A giant golden bull was standing in the garden! But this wasn't scary — the bull's fur shimmered like honey, and his horns gleamed with starlight. He was moonlight gardening, planting glowing seeds that became instant flowers.
"Hello, little friend," the bull said kindly. "I'm Barnaby, and I grow dreams."
Mittens' tail puffed with excitement. "I'm Mittens the spy! I investigate everything unusual."
Barnaby chuckled. "Then you might help me. I've lost my most special seed — it's a tiny goldenfish that swims through air instead of water. Without it, children's dreams won't have enough magic."
Mittens promised to help. She searched everywhere — under the porch, behind the rosebushes, even up the old oak tree. Finally, she spotted something glowing near the garden gate. It was a small white rectangle the humans called an iPhone, and the goldenfish was swimming happily above it, attracted by its light!
"Got you!" Mittens pounced gently, catching the fish in her soft paws.
The goldenfish bubbled with laughter. "Thank you, Mittens! You're the best spy ever."
Barnaby planted the goldenfish seed, and suddenly the whole garden bloomed with sparkling flowers. "For your help," Barnaby said, "you may have one wish."
Mittens thought carefully. "I wish for all cats to have secret adventures, and for children to always believe in magic."
Barnaby smiled. "Granted. And Mittens — keep being curious. The best discoveries come to those who never stop wondering."
That night, Mittens curled up with her family, purring happily. She had solved the mystery, made new friends, and learned that the most wonderful adventures are the ones you share with others. And somewhere, in gardens everywhere, other cats began their own midnight spying missions, ready to discover magic in unexpected places.
